![](https://img-blog.csdnimg.cn/20201014180756919.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
swift
文章平均质量分 74
世界里的一粒沙
不积硅步无以至千里
展开
-
自定义滑条封装含有百分比例显示(swift版)
之前经常会用UIProgress的控件,但是有时候有的地方会要求你上面有个显示比例的地方,所以为了方便以后用到就自己封装了一个小的demo!(http://img.blog.csdn.net/20160412110730682) 你只需在ViewController中写下如下简单代码便可实现 var progress:ProVSpre progress = ProVSp原创 2016-04-12 11:15:40 · 1016 阅读 · 0 评论 -
CAGradientLayer应用及效果
大家可能对layer很是了解了,那么对于它的子类CAGradientLayer是否也是有同样的了解了呢,下面我们看一看CAGradientLayer如何去应用。CAGradientLayer主要是用于一些控件的渐变的效果。尤其是在颜色上面 //测试渐变layer的应用 let gradientlayer = CAGradientLayer()原创 2016-04-12 14:11:44 · 303 阅读 · 0 评论 -
CATextLayer的简单介绍
从名字中我们可以看到text说明是跟text编辑有关系的,CATextLayer可以实现半个字的颜色的变化,我们知道富文本类可以实现将某个字的颜色进行变化。CATextLayer实现了更详细的变化。效果如下哦:实现这个效果主要用了三个layer层的视图,其中CATextLayer是在最上层作为遮罩效果实现的,而其余的两层都是简单的CALayer层,而这两个简单的层则是决定了你所要设原创 2016-04-13 10:40:35 · 388 阅读 · 0 评论 -
UIImageView圆角设置swift
对UIimage和UIImageView做一个扩展,各自扩展了一个函数如下所示:其作用主要是避免了离屏渲染则cpu的的消耗减小。如果只有几个的话可以使用layer层的cornerRadius和masksToBounds,毕竟用起来比较方便,如果你的项目中有太多的圆角如果用上面的方法会产生离屏渲染会降低cpu的运行效率,则可以采用下面方法:import Foundationi原创 2016-04-27 14:16:36 · 1660 阅读 · 0 评论